Output ef859c5d558d93f821d8d4aaf67c7117e44e7f5a1b68ddf71224ffe074be73d7:0

value
76924600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e708a84bf12543342211bb28e808b01b0f8af9 OP_EQUAL
address
3QCWvFAsieVdZQGLSJyTasanFecSJnUkT3
transaction
ef859c5d558d93f821d8d4aaf67c7117e44e7f5a1b68ddf71224ffe074be73d7
spent
true